Missing boy, 14 last seen in Anfield six days ago

Police have appealed for help in tracing a 14-year-old boy who is missing from home.

Connor Beswick, was last seen at 11.50pm on January 19 in Hornsey Road, Anfield. Police have said Connor, 14, is known to frequent parts of Liverpool and Knowsley.

When last seen Connor was wearing a black North Face coat, black North Face tracksuit bottoms and dark coloured Nike trainers.

He is five feet six inches tall and has shoulder length dark brown hair.

A police spokesperson said to the ECHO : "We are appealing for help in finding a 14 year-old boy who is missing from home in Liverpool.

"Connor Beswick, was last seen on 11.50pm on Tuesday 19th January in Hornsey Road, Anfield. He is described as a white male, 5ft 6in tall, of medium build with shoulder length dark brown hair and blue eyes. He speaks with a Liverpool accent.

"When last seen he was wearing a black North Face coat, black North Face tracksuit bottoms and black/grey Nike trainers. He is known to frequent the Liverpool and Knowsley areas."

Police have asked for anyone who has seen Connor or knows of his whereabouts to DM @MerPolCC or @missingpeople on 116 000.
